Avantages

Spring is full of smart and talented people - it is so rewarding to work together to change the mental health space. Everyone genuinely cares about the mission and supporting our members to get better faster. The team also spends time celebrating big wins and acknowledging each others hard work. Things are growing quickly so there are plenty of opportunities to stretch yourself and take on more responsibilities. There are also a lot of new hires that are bringing so much expertise that it is exciting to think about where we are going next.

Inconvénients

Rapid growth brings some pains - it's hard to still know everyone as headcount rises. I don't personally feel like this is a con because I love start ups, but if you don't love constant change, stretch goals, and high speeds, then this company will feel tough.

Avantages

The company's products help people in meaningful ways

Inconvénients

Company is very poorly misled. There isn't a real vision or culture. In general, ways of working here are scattered and immature. We have a new SDLC every 10 months or so. Constant re-orgs and changes in leadership cause instability. Teams and ICs are re-allocated every 3–6 months. Priorities are constantly shifting. "Science will win" except when it comes to evaluating AI's place in our product. Sudden AI focus despite not having a real vision for how it aligns with our mission. Leaders who report directly to the CEO often cycle out every year or so. There seems to be very little awareness or ownership that leaders aren't set up for success. The company says it cares about employee "thriving" but promotes leaders with very poor scores. It seems to be more of a vanity metric/tool to fire people.
